我正在尝试创建一个从文件中读取的单词列表,该列表按单词的长度排列。为此,我尝试使用带有自定义比较器的std::set。
class Longer {
public:
bool operator() (const string& a, const string& b)
{ return a.size() > b.size();}
};
set<string, Longer> make_dictionary (const string& ifile){
// produces a map of words in 'ifile
我似乎在这里遗漏了一些非常明显的东西,但是为什么给定的代码段可以工作呢?
n=int(input())
for i in range(n):
for i in range(4):
team, score=input().split(" ")
if team[0]=="B":
b=score
elif team[0]=="R":
r=score
elif team[0]=="E":
e=sc
我正在考虑的例子类似于unix,它有一个允许次数的登录规则。
如果我正在旅行,为了能够修改.htaccess文件,我想要做的是设置一个小窗口。
<Files wp-login.php>
Order Deny,Allow
Deny from All
Allow from XX.XX.X3.*
Allow from XX.XX.X4.*
而是以整个Deny,Allow为例
因此,它只允许特定的硬编码IP范围,但每天5分钟允许所有的ip地址,这样我就可以从一个未列出的IP地址登录,并用我正在工作的IP范围替换.htaccess文件。
我想我可以设置关闭和打开的文件,并让它在cron
我使用的是一个键,其中TreeMap是一个枚举,值是一个整数。
TreeMap<Ingredient, Integer> inv;
public Inventory(){
inv = new TreeMap<Ingredient, Integer>();
inv.put(Ingredient.COFFEE, 10);
inv.put(Ingredient.DECAF_COFFEE, 10);
// and so on
}
配料类被定义为
public enum Ingred